- Equity in Athletics Disclosure Act Report 2020 – The Equity in Athletics Disclosure Actopens in a new window (EADA) Report is an annual report completed by coeducational institutions that participate in Title IV (the federal student financial aid program) and have an intercollegiate athletic program. The report overviews institutional participation rates and financial data, summarizing the institution’s commitment to providing equitable opportunities for students who participate in women and men’s intercollegiate athletics teams.
The data is also submitted to the United States Department of Education (DOE) for the annual EADA survey and can be accessed at the following site: http://ope.ed.gov/athleticsopens in a new window.
Institutions are required to make this report available to campus community members including students, prospective students and the public by October 15 each year in order to comply with DOE regulations.
